Idyllically situated on the riverbank in the picturesque conservation village of Sonning-on-Thames near Reading, this charming hotel prides itself on friendly and professional service at all times. Located halfway between Reading and Henley, with easy access to highways A4 and the M4, the Great House offers ample free parking. The hotel provides 3-star hotel accommodations, a contemporary restaurant with an eclectic menu and a relaxed bar. Only a few miles from the center of Reading, yet in a relaxed, rural, riverside location, the Great House has 50 individually designed bedrooms, including 4 suites. Bedrooms are located in separate buildings: the original White Hart Hotel; the 16th century palace yard and hideaway; the 17th century coach house, and the clock tower, which houses 18 executive bedrooms.
